Programming has been my passion for a long while now. I would like to think that I always liked it, however, the first time I learnt how to code, in highschool, I had no clue what i was doing and did not even try to. But there was a moment in my life which changed that, it was a simple C++ code, not more than a few lines, but this time I DID undestand it wholesomely, so I started to write more and more, in order to challenge myself.
The feeling I got back then, is the same that is driving me forward in the field today. The problem solving aspects of software development are the ones fuelling my enthusiasm for the subject. I like to mentally challenge myself, because I believe that it is the only way one can improve.
Before coming to UK to study Computer Science, I studied bachelors degree in Business Administration in Shanghai, China for two years, preceeded by 3 years of language study in Beijing. That gave me a good base of knowledge in Mandarin language, as well as limited knowledge in the professional field I was involved with.
I am looking at projects that are related to the fields of software development in Java programming language. However, I also am willing to get involved with Web development.
Having programming as a hobby prior to taking the course gave me a bif head start and now, by the end of first year I am confident in my programming skills. Which can be seen in my marks, which are one of the highest in my programming modules, some of which have over 200 students.
Game enthusiast, irrespective of them being digital or not. Like to spend free time socializing, drawing and reading articles to increase the amount of knowledge about the world we live in.
